Diamonds are cut to maximize the sparkle, fire, brilliance and overall visual beauty of a diamond. The cut is a measure of light performance as light hits a diamond. Before a diamond is cut and polished, it is known as a rough diamond. The skin of the rough diamond is opaque and often difficult to see through. .
